A243957 Primes of the form 2*n^2+66*n+31. 2
499, 787, 1471, 1867, 2767, 3271, 4999, 5647, 8599, 13099, 14107, 16231, 19687, 22171, 24799, 33547, 40099, 43591, 52951, 63211, 65371, 67567, 79087, 88951, 94099, 99391, 104827, 107599, 116131, 119047, 124987, 131071, 153499, 160231, 167107, 177691, 192307 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
1,1
COMMENTS
Primes of the form 36*A056115(k)+31.
Conjecture: 2^a(n)-1 is not prime; in other words, these primes are included in A054723.
